Based on our analysis of NIST CSF 2.0 coverage, core features, integrations, company size fit, here is our conclusion:
Malware analysts and incident responders who need to quickly identify which parts of a suspicious binary are actually malicious will find ThreatCheck's multi-scanner approach more useful than single-engine tools; it cross-references results from multiple AV engines to isolate genuine threats from false positives. The tool is free and available on GitHub with active community contributions, lowering the barrier to adoption in resource-constrained security teams. Skip this if you need automated triage at scale or integration with your SOAR platform; ThreatCheck works best as a manual analysis step for experienced practitioners who understand its limitations as a detection layer rather than a replacement for endpoint protection.
SOC teams handling malware submissions at scale need Spectra Analyze because its binary analysis engine covers 400+ file formats without requiring sandbox detonation for initial triage, saving analyst time on low-risk files. The platform's NIST DE.AE coverage includes 500+ search expressions and relationship graphing that surfaces IOC patterns faster than manual hunting; the integrated sandbox closes the dynamic analysis gap when static analysis is inconclusive. Skip this if your threat intel team is the primary user,Spectra is built for hands-on analysts doing forensics, not for feed aggregation or alert routing.
